From 373cd80081cedaa942b42d26d0fecad466ebf7c8 Mon Sep 17 00:00:00 2001 From: Peter Hutterer Date: Thu, 4 Jan 2024 11:12:28 +1000 Subject: [PATCH] dix: use valuator_mask_free() to free the last touches vmask No functional effect since that one is just a free() call anyway. --- dix/devices.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/dix/devices.c b/dix/devices.c index bdbe2dc73..d58f96b47 100644 --- a/dix/devices.c +++ b/dix/devices.c @@ -1021,7 +1021,7 @@ CloseDevice(DeviceIntPtr dev) free(dev->config_info); /* Allocated in xf86ActivateDevice. */ free(dev->last.scroll); for (j = 0; j < dev->last.num_touches; j++) - free(dev->last.touches[j].valuators); + valuator_mask_free(&dev->last.touches[j].valuators); free(dev->last.touches); dev->config_info = NULL; dixFreePrivates(dev->devPrivates, PRIVATE_DEVICE);